Gathered Gallery Completes Outdoor Sculpture

  • Gathered Gallery completed and installed an outdoor sculpture for Sylvania Southview High School. The 9 foot piece was commissioned by the graduating class of 2020. Reflection Column, is made of a found block of local sandstone, mild steel, and coated Pilkington glass products, and has been permanently installed in front of the school’s entrance.

Traver Gallery Shows Work by Matt Szosz 

  • A surprise exhibition, Luftschlösser, which means “air palace” or daydream
  • The Inflatables series is a body of work that Matt first began more than a decade ago. This series is an investigation of how innovating within a process can expand the materials’ available formal vocabulary. While growing more technically refined, these recent works direct airflow through linear forms, recursive labyrinths reminiscent of three-dimensional line drawings. With their subtle and mutable surfaces, these sculptures reward the attentive observation with new characteristics and perspectives.

Ohio Governor Announces Money for Art 

  • Governor Mike DeWine recently announced the allocation of twenty million CARES Act dollars to the State of Ohio’s arts sector.
